IT'S great to see another huge investment in Newport with the opening of the £10 million Warburtons factory in Rogerstone.

More than 200 jobs have been created at the new plant which formed after the company outgrew its premises in Treforest, Pontypridd.

It will produce some 150,000 loaves of bread and fruit loaves 356 days of the year to send to shops across South Wales and Bristol.

Bosses there, as at so many other companies, saw Newport's many attractions for business including its location and the regeneration going on within the city.

Newport has attracted huge investment in recent years from companies such as Quinn Radiators and from government relocations like the Prison Service.
